    Unhappy as a customer. We rented a hospital bed for 1 month. It was delivered and setup properly so no issues there. Because the head portion was raised we did not see that the frame was badly bent. All we knew was that the bed did not "feel right". We bought a $200 gel topper and tried that. Same problem. My wife would roll to the left a bit not knowing why. We could not use the bed. My wife did report the issue to the store but there was no action on their part. When returning the bed we found the bent frame. I brought this up to David, the owner as I understand it. For an unusable bed rented for ~250/month, David was not interested in making any resolution accept for an insulting $20 check as compensation. I rejected it and all future business with ACG Medical Supply.
